## Parcel-Tracking Webhook: Delivery Semantics

The Cartwheel webhook pushes scan events to merchant endpoints with at-least-once delivery. Retries use exponential backoff with jitter; endpoints failing past the cutoff are quarantined until the next release window. Release managers should verify these values match the rollout plan before promoting. The constants governing retry and quarantine behavior are shown below.

tuning constants:
QUOTAS = {
    "druwyn": 5,
    "holix": 5,
    "zorath": 5,
    "holwyn": 10,
}

14:22 — The Tidyhawk sweeper started flagging plugin-created scratch volumes as orphans, because third-party resources don't carry the ownership label our core services set automatically. Heads up, plugin authors: anything unlabeled older than 30 minutes got reclaimed during this window. We paused the sweeper at 14:31 and restored what we could from snapshots. Going forward, label your resources — docs updated. The faulty heuristic shipped in the build identified below.

build token for kagaf-hahof: htk14_9d3d4d26d7d8de

Subject: Contrast cut-over is done!

Hi plugin folks — quick recap. Over the weekend we finished the cut-over for the Brightloom contrast audit: all core themes now meet the new minimum contrast ratios, and the old palette tokens are gone. If your plugin hardcoded hex values, you'll want to switch to the semantic tokens before the next release, or things will look washed out on the Duskmode theme. The theme engine now ships with these contrast settings baked in:

deployment values, kajep-kageg:
[praix]
host = praix.paliqcorp.corp
user = praix_svc
database = praix_prod